Abstract: A computer-implemented method of processing at least one image of a retina of an eye acquired by an ophthalmic imaging device, wherein the at least one image shows a texture of the retina. The method comprises processing a first image of the at least one image using a noise reduction algorithm based on machine learning to generate a de-noised image of the retina, wherein the texture of the retina shown in the first image is at least partially removed by the noise reduction algorithm to generate the de-noised image. The method further comprises combining a second image of the at least one image with the de-noised image to generate at least one hybrid image of the retina which shows more of the texture of the retina than the de-noised image.

Abstract: A method of method of processing optical coherence tomography, OCT, image data representing an OCT image of a retina of an eye, to generate mapping data which maps out a predetermined band of a plurality of distinct bands which extend across the OCT image and correspond to respective anatomical layers of the retina. The method comprises: receiving the OCT image data; processing A-scan data of the received OCT image data to generate data indicative of sequences of A-scan elements corresponding to the predetermined band of the plurality of distinct bands and having respective A-scan element values that vary in accordance with a predetermined pattern; and generating the mapping data by applying a line-finding algorithm to determine a line passing through the sequences of A-scan elements indicated by the generated data.
